Key insights

🔍You can dye a camel saddle by placing it on a camel and right-clicking it with dye.

🐰Naming a rabbit 'Toast' will turn it black and white.

⛏️You can repair Iron Golems by right-clicking them with the item used to create them.

🕴️Weakness potions make you unable to hit mobs with your fist or a stick, but you can still hit them with a stone sword or higher.

🎣Hitting a mob through fire with a fishing rod does not set them on fire.
